One day in fall,
Between the buildings tall,
In a park where we went to play,
A solitary egg did lay.
Stood around and saw it from the bottom to tip,
"I wonder how'd It look as an omlette? "
Said Fatso as frooti he did sip.
Asked Ram , " Should we take it to a Vet? "
"Try poking it with a pin.
whoever succeeds in bringing it out,
will a crepe ; win."
Said Cyrus with a grin.
"Don't do things so cruel!!
Only the things which if happened to you ,
You'd definitely not mind;
Should you do to others.
Besides it always pays to be Kind.
The other day , I helped a Blind cross,
Rewarded was I , with bear shaped candies ; which in shops you won't find.
After he safely reached his doss."
Reported Abdul as he adjusted his glasses.
"That's just you being a consequentialist,
You'd NOT help him if he had nothing to give?
If poor and terribly desolate he was,
You'd deny him bread to live?"
said Teresa feigning a smile.
"Oh! I'd give him bread.
We have plenty at home.
I won't go hungry to bed ,
even if to him , I gave away some."
Retorted Abdul.
"What if hungry you had to go for lunch?
will you still help him with your share?
As for the impoverished ; you sincerely care!!"
Said she with a flare.
Silent was abdul for the rest.
Must've thought to let her win ; was for the best.
Everytime they talked ,
He felt a thump in his chest.
"Oye!!!!! What about the egg?
I feel bad for it.
Once the pavements are lit,
and off we go to eat,
A cat is sure to spot it ,
For it's kids ; a requim of supper it would fit."
Said Digambar while waving his hand.
The kids started to pass it around.
Asking one another to hide it with them.
When they brought it to the apartment building,
The Watchman interuppted with a hem.
A commotion huge , the moms did cause;
Shouted at the kids , without a pause.
The Husbands stood by talking about cricket,
As if in consensus who the BOSS was.
Just when the sound reached its peak,
There was a crack,
and came out a foundling meek.
Its mother did it seek,
As over the shell shards ;
It did cauiously peek.
An eerie silence fell ; as if the hall had been jinxed by a spell.
The little one afraid ,
Didn't come out , because between friend and foe ; it couldn't tell.
